Adipocyte Metabolism

Meaning

Adipocyte metabolism refers to the complex biochemical processes occurring within fat cells, or adipocytes, which govern energy storage and release throughout the body. These cells are not merely passive storage depots but are active endocrine organs, secreting various adipokines that influence systemic energy balance. Understanding this cellular activity is crucial in clinical endocrinology, as dysfunction directly contributes to metabolic disorders like insulin resistance and obesity. This critical process involves the dynamic interplay between lipogenesis, the synthesis of fat, and lipolysis, the breakdown of fat.
